  • Visual Basic .NET Programming

    Choosing a Project Template

    Template Use this template to create:

    Windows

    Applications

    Standard Windows-based

    applications

    Class Library

    Class libraries that provide similar

    functionality to Microsoft Active X

    DLL

    The Visual Studio .Net IDE * Property of STIPage 5 of 30

    DLL

    Windows

    Control

    Library

    User-defined Windows control

    projects

    Web Control

    Library

    User-defined Web controls that

    can be reused on Web page

    Console

    Application

    Console application that will run

    from a command line

    Windows

    Service

    Windows services that will run

    continuously regardless of whether

    a user is logged on or not

  • Visual Basic .NET Programming

    Creating VB .NET Projects

    Assemblies

    one or more files that make up a Visual

    Studio Application

    key concept in .NET development

    The Visual Studio .Net IDE * Property of STIPage 7 of 30

    serve as building block for all .NET

    applications.

    Namespaces

    used in .NET Framework assemblies

    organize classes, interface and modules

    into a structure that is easy to understand

  • Visual Basic .NET Programming

    Setting Project References

    Adding References

    select the current project in Solution

    Explorer then Project > Add Reference

    The Visual Studio .Net IDE * Property of STIPage 9 of 30

    click .NET, COM, or Projects tab

    locate the required component in the list

    you may click the Browse tab to locate the

    file

    repeat step 3 for all the components you

    require, and then OK
